What is the Lifeline Telephone Assistance Program Application?
The Lifeline Telephone Assistance Program Application is a crucial government form utilized by eligible residents of Indiana to receive discounts on telephone services. This program aims to provide financial relief to low-income families, ensuring they have access to essential communication services. Completing the lifeline application form helps individuals certify their participation in various assistance programs, enabling them to benefit from reduced rates on their monthly phone bills.

Eligibility Criteria for the Lifeline Telephone Assistance Program Application
To qualify for the Lifeline Telephone Assistance Program, applicants must meet specific income criteria or participate in designated assistance programs. In Indiana, eligibility is determined by federal poverty guidelines, ensuring that support reaches those most in need. It's essential for individuals to review these criteria thoroughly before submitting their application.

Required Documents and Supporting Materials
When applying for the Lifeline Telephone Assistance Program, applicants must provide certain documents to verify their eligibility. Essential supporting materials include:
-
Proof of income, such as a pay stub or tax return.
-
Documentation showing enrollment in qualifying assistance programs.
-
Identification, such as a driver's license or state ID.
These documents help confirm your eligibility and must accompany your application for successful processing.

Who is eligible for the Lifeline Telephone Assistance Program?
Eligibility generally includes low-income individuals and families in Indiana who either participate in certain government assistance programs or meet federal poverty guidelines.
What documents do I need to submit with my application?
You will need to provide personal identification documents and proof of participation in assistance programs or proof of income, depending on your eligibility.
How do I submit the application once completed?
Once you've finished filling out the application, submit it along with any required supporting documents to your local phone company via mail or their preferred submission method.
Are there deadlines for submitting the Lifeline application?
While there may not be a specific application deadline, it's advisable to submit your application as soon as possible to start receiving any applicable discounts.
What are common mistakes to avoid when filling out the form?
Common mistakes include not providing complete information, failing to check eligibility criteria, and submitting without the required supporting documents.
How will I know if my application has been processed?
Typically, your local phone company will contact you regarding your application status after processing. Keep an eye on your mail or email for notifications.
Is there a fee associated with applying for the Lifeline program?
There are usually no fees to apply for the Lifeline program. However, check with your local phone company for specific details or any potential costs.
